WHERE DOES THE MONEY COME FROM?
67%Substrates
Substrates 67%Raw Materials and Other 33%
67% of all revenue comes from a single line: Substrates.

That much dependence is a risk in itself: if this one line weakens, the whole company feels it directly.

THE BRIGHT SIDE · 1/2
Strong cash, light debt

There is $120.3M in the vault; even if every debt were paid off, $55.5M would remain.

THE RISKS · 1/2
Running at a loss

A loss of $21.3M against $88.3M in annual sales. And on top of that, sales fell from the year before.

2
THE RISKS · 2/2
Executives lean toward selling

Over the last 12 months, executives reported 69 sells against just 18 buys. Not an alarm bell by itself, but a number worth watching.
